Utah Code § 53G-6-602

Identifying records -- Reporting requirements

(1) Upon notification by the division of a missing child in accordance with Section 53-10-203, a
school in which that child is currently or was previously enrolled shall flag the record of that
child in a manner that whenever a copy of or information regarding the record is requested, the
school is alerted to the fact that the record is that of a missing child.
(2) The school shall immediately report any request concerning flagged records or knowledge as to
the whereabouts of any missing child to the division.
(3) Upon notification by the division that a missing child has been recovered, the school shall
remove the flag from that child's record.
Renumbered and Amended by Chapter 3, 2018 General Session
